The New Zealand Education Sector Architectural Framework (ESAF) aims to deliver interoperability across the Education Sector through the ability to:

Share a common understanding of data and information;

Transfer information based on business rules;

Individuals being able to identify themselves in an online environment;

This will also involve authorising access to services and information and;

Locating services and information within the sector.

The individual projects that comprise the ESAF work programme include:

The Education Sector Data Model;

The Education Sector Metadata Schema;

Education Sector Intergration Services

Education Sector Federated Search and;

The Education Sector Authorisation and Authentication project.
